Miscellaneous Resolution No, 5801 September 2, 1971 BY: PERSONNEL PRACTICES COMMITTEE - Mr. Mainland IN RE: TWO ADDITIONAL STUDENT POSITIONS - TREASURER'S OFFICE TO THE OAKLAND COUNTY B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S' Mr. Chairman, Ladies and Gentlemen: WHEREAS, the Oakland County Treasurer's Office now has two "Student" positions and finds it has work for two more on an immediate basis; and WHEREAS, students work four hours per day during the school year and eight hours per day in the summer with an annual salary cost of $2,400 each, and the cost for the remainder of 1971 would be $560.00 each or $1,120.00 for two; and WHEREAS, the request is being made now because this is the time when students are available for full year commitment; N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ED that the Personnel Practices Committee recommends that two additional "Student" positions be granted to the Oakland County Treasurer's Office with immediate effect.
